Overall Purpose
The Health \& Safety Advisor is responsible for ensuring organisation wide H\&S compliance, mitigating operational risks and working closely with managers to continuously improve safety performance and workplace culture. This role acts as a key internal resource for all safety matters, providing guidance, driving compliance initiatives and maintaining robust health and safety frameworks.

Technical competencies:
· Experience: prior experience in a dedicated Health \& Safety advisory role within an engineering or manufacturing environment with practical oversight of machinery safety regimes or similar
· Technical proficiencies: comprehensive knowledge of current UK health and safety regulations, risk assessment methodologies and incident investigation techniques. Robust working knowledge of UK safety legislation, specifically HASWA, PUWER 1998, LOLER 1998
· Education / qualifications: NEBOSH National General Certificate in Occupational Health and Safety (or equivalent). HNC (science / engineering or similar)
· Behavioural: strong attention to detail, personal accountability, analytical, problem solving skills and a patient, methodical approach to work, work under pressure, to tight deadlines, a structured \& methodical approach to compliance and logbook maintenance
